The AD5621BKSZ from Analog Devices Inc. is a highly precise 12-bit digital-to-analog converter (DAC) offering compact size and high performance, making it suitable for a wide range of applications. This particular model is part of the nanoDAC® series, which are known for their low power consumption and on-chip output buffering, allowing them to drive capacitive loads directly.
Key Features:
- Resolution: The AD5621BKSZ provides a 12-bit resolution, ensuring fine granularity in the analog output for applications that demand high levels of accuracy.
- Interface: It features a versatile 3-wire serial interface that is compatible with SPI, QSPI™, MICROWIRE™, and DSP interface standards, allowing for easy integration into a variety of systems.
- Power Efficiency: With a typical supply current of just 400 µA, this device is ideal for battery-powered applications and other power-sensitive systems.
- On-Chip Reference: An integrated 2.5 V, 2 ppm/°C reference voltage provides a stable and precise reference, reducing the need for external components and simplifying design.
- Output Buffer: The on-chip rail-to-rail output buffer allows the DAC to drive capacitive loads, which is particularly useful in isolated data acquisition systems.
- Packaging: The AD5621BKSZ comes in a compact SC70 package, offering a space-saving solution for systems where board space is at a premium.
Applications:
- Process Control
- Data Acquisition Systems
- Portable Battery-Powered Instruments
- Digital Gain and Offset Adjustment
- Programmable Voltage and Current Sources
